-- Features a brand-new foreword by Patricia Hitchcock, the director's daughter -- Illustrated with hundreds of photos -- Updated edition will tie in with the anniversary of Universal Studios He is the undisputed master of terror and suspense, and is probably the most popular and celebrated movie maker ever. He brought us Psycho, North by Northwest, Rear Window, Vertigo, Shadow of a Doubt, The Birds, and Strangers on a Train, among others. His name is Alfred Hitchcock, the man who made us afraid to step into a shower or spy on our neighbors or visit Mount Rushmore. His movies continue to inspire countless filmmakers almost twenty years after his passing. Indeed, Hitchcockian is still used to describe the cinematic techniques he created. Included in this new edition is a complete and up-to-date listing of all Hitchcock movies and television shows available on video and DVD.
